Oracle入门教程:从基础到实践
需积分: 0 99 浏览量
更新于2024-07-20
收藏 3.26MB PDF 举报
"Oracle经典教程"
本教程是一份深入浅出的Oracle入门指南,旨在帮助初学者快速掌握Oracle数据库系统的基础知识。教程结构清晰,内容精炼,覆盖了Oracle的重要概念和实际操作。
首先,教程从“走进Oracle”开始,介绍了Oracle数据库的基本概述,包括Oracle的起源、特点以及它作为对象关系型数据库的特性。这一部分讲解了Oracle的安装过程,让读者能够在自己的环境中搭建Oracle数据库。同时,教程还提到了Oracle的各种客户端工具,如SQL*Plus,使得用户能够方便地与数据库进行交互。
接下来,教程详细阐述了Oracle服务的管理和控制,包括如何启动和关闭数据库实例,以及Oracle用户和权限的管理。这部分内容对于理解数据库的安全性和访问控制至关重要。通过学习,读者可以创建和管理用户,设置不同级别的权限,确保数据的安全性。
在SQL数据操作和查询章节中,教程涵盖了SQL语言的基础知识,如数据类型、表的创建、DML(数据操纵语言)操作(INSERT、UPDATE、DELETE)、查询操作和各种操作符的使用。此外,还介绍了更高级的查询技巧,帮助读者提升数据检索的能力。
子查询和常用函数章节深入讨论了子查询的应用,如何在查询中嵌套查询以获取更复杂的数据。此外,还讲解了Oracle的伪列和各种内置函数,使得数据处理更加灵活高效。
在表空间、数据库对象这一部分,教程详细介绍了Oracle数据库中的各种对象,如表、同义词、序列、视图和索引,以及表空间的概念和管理,这些都是数据库设计和优化的重要元素。
PL/SQL程序设计章节则引导读者进入Oracle的编程世界,介绍了PL/SQL的基础语法、数据类型、控制结构、动态SQL以及异常处理,使读者能够编写存储过程和函数,实现数据库的业务逻辑。
Oracle应用于.Net平台章节,主要讲解如何在.Net环境中使用Oracle,包括ADO.NET与Oracle的结合,以及如何在抽象工厂模式中集成Oracle连接,为.NET开发者提供了实践指导。
最后,教程还涉及了数据库的导入导出操作,包括EXP和IMP工具的使用,以及在数据迁移过程中可能遇到的问题和解决策略。
这份教程全面覆盖了Oracle数据库的基础知识和实战技能,无论是对数据库管理员还是开发者,都是一份极具价值的学习资料。通过学习,读者可以迅速掌握Oracle的核心概念和操作,为进一步深入学习和应用Oracle打下坚实基础。
2021-11-16 上传
2018-09-01 上传
2024-11-01 上传
2024-11-01 上传
#码道老刘#
- 粉丝: 178
- 资源: 27
最新资源
- IEEE 14总线系统Simulink模型开发指南与案例研究
- STLinkV2.J16.S4固件更新与应用指南
- Java并发处理的实用示例分析
- Linux下简化部署与日志查看的Shell脚本工具
- Maven增量编译技术详解及应用示例
- MyEclipse 2021.5.24a最新版本发布
- Indore探索前端代码库使用指南与开发环境搭建
- 电子技术基础数字部分PPT课件第六版康华光
- MySQL 8.0.25版本可视化安装包详细介绍
- 易语言实现主流搜索引擎快速集成
- 使用asyncio-sse包装器实现服务器事件推送简易指南
- Java高级开发工程师面试要点总结
- R语言项目ClearningData-Proj1的数据处理
- VFP成本费用计算系统源码及论文全面解析
- Qt5与C++打造书籍管理系统教程
- React 应用入门:开发、测试及生产部署教程